I placed 2 orders. My first order was 2 pastries ($12), both were good hence went ahead and placed the 2nd order. It was all good until my second order. I was highly disappointed with the quality and the quantity of the food. I ordered chicken pesto sandwich and it was priced at $13.50 + taxes + a cup of soup that I ordered, a total of $17+ Soup was nice but the sandwich was just not worth it! Either you increase the quantity and make it better or simply decrease the price. I am sorry to say but I felt cheated. The bread was overly crunchy and did hurt. You can see the pics attached. It's more than toasted, kind of looks burnt. There was just a small piece of chicken, just 1 tiny sized pepper (which was negligible), very little mushrooms and the rest of the sandwich was just loaded with tomatoes. It neither was worth it nor tasted good. Dont cheat the customers please. Please avoid ordering the food here!
*3 stars knocked off just for the sandwich.

I have been coming here every week to try most of the menu items and today I’m leaving my honest review, Unless you are buying the speciality treats from the display the menu is mediocre, A little over priced for the size of sandwiches and portions and the “breakfast feature” is not a feature it’s a regular menu item that’s listed every day on the same sign it’s not a feature at all. I would strongly suggest changing it once in a while. A little honesty goes a long way when presenting your products. I would come here for the treats and bread but I’m avoiding dining out here anymore unfortunately. It’s just not worth the costs.

I was introduced to this establishment on this visit to Kelowna. Typically I've been taken to Bliss, a similar establishment in many respects offering coffee, pastries etc.. I will say that I much preferred Bread Co. I found their prices more reasonable and frankly, the quality much better, one example to compare is their sausage roll. Bliss use a hot dog (they refer to it as a lean beef sausage, c'mon people, it's a hot dog) and surround it with way to much pastry. They call it a sausage wrap and charge $6.95. Bread Co make their own sausage roll and charge under $3.00. From here on in when visiting relatives in Kelowna, I will return to Bread Co. Lastly, the staff were excellent.
